Nanyang Business School invites applications for a Senior Assistant Manager, Dean's Office Coordination.
Reporting directly to the Dean, this role provides coordination and analytical support to facilitate the smooth functioning of the Dean's Office. The position supports governance processes, institutional coordination and selected school-level initiatives. The job holder will work closely with academic leaders, faculty members and corporate services units to support decision making, administrative operations and implementation of initiatives within the School.
This role is suited for individuals who are organised, analytical and able to work effectively with multiple stakeholders in a dynamic academic environment.
Key Responsibilities:
Provide secretariat support for meetings chaired by the Dean, including preparation of materials, drafting minutes and tracking follow-up actions.
Conduct research and benchmarking on trends within the Institute of Higher Learning (IHL) landscape and academic programmes at NTU and peer universities.
Collect, consolidate and analyse data relating to academic programmes and institutional metrics to support leadership discussions and planning.
Provide administrative coordination for the Dean's grant applications, including tracking timelines, coordinating documentation and liaising with co-applicants.
Coordinate operational matters within the Dean's Office and ensure alignment with university administrative policies and procedures.
Support governance processes by maintaining proper documentation and facilitating coordination of matters routed through the Dean's Office.
Liaise with academic divisions, corporate services units and central administrative offices to facilitate implementation of initiatives and administrative matters.
Coordinate institutional engagements and visits involving the Dean and external partners.
Support school-level initiatives such as NBS Knowledge Management and administrative process improvement efforts.
